Transaction 505db3a95c54c63d70ed16bc76f2cf47c8a8c606cbd2bda0042e1cf45825e74d

1 Input
2 Outputs
  • 505db3a95c54c63d70ed16bc76f2cf47c8a8c606cbd2bda0042e1cf45825e74d:0
  • value  1588858649
    address  1ELP7xdTmuzGe2VMCJQ6PE4zmF4CnxPSte
  • 505db3a95c54c63d70ed16bc76f2cf47c8a8c606cbd2bda0042e1cf45825e74d:1
  • value  154807167
    address  3LykCrLCZ53svcR3g9m3GkSNx3UgytdjAv